Opinion
— Appeal by the defendant from a judgment of the Supreme Court, Kings County (Corrierro, J.), rendered March 12, 1985, convicting him of grand larceny in the third degree, upon his plea of guilty, and imposing sentence.
Ordered that the judgment is affirmed (see, CPL 210.45 [5] [b]; People v Friscia, 51 NY2d 845; People v Taranovich, 37 NY2d 442). Mangano, J. P., Brown, Weinstein and Spatt, JJ., concur.
